How to measure dielectric constant using a microstrip line?

How do I measure the dielectric constant of a substrate using a microstrip line? Someone said that I could layout a microstrip line on a the substrate backed by a ground plane and use that fixture to do the measurement. Any help on how to do it?

You would typically use a resonator such as a microstrip ring.

use TDR to measure velocity then derive dielectric constant.

Er changes with F so a TDR will give poor results. A resonator is one of the more accurate ways to do it. You can build several resonators at different frequencies, an a notch in magnitude response is easy to measure at a precise frequency; no phase needed.
